The actual reason why some WWE shows are soft in ticket sales is that they're hitting up the same towns multiple times in a year that aren't really big enough to have two big crowds for both shows. I think in the past maybe they would've done one TV show and one house show in some of these cities, but without the house shows, they're just doing another Raw or SmackDown. I expect that next year they'll try to spread it out a little more and not come to the same town too often.
